This data paper documents the SmartQHSE Open HSE Data collection: eleven openly licensed (CC BY 4.0) machine-readable datasets covering occupational health, safety, and environment (HSE) performance benchmarks, regulations, hazardous-chemical exposure limits, OSHA enforcement, GCC heat-illness work-stoppage rules, and a 43-incident extended reference of named process-safety and industrial disasters from 1911 to 2024. Version 2 (this version): Expanded from six datasets (v1, April 2026) to eleven datasets (May 2026). Adds GCC Heat Illness Regulations 2026, OSHA Most-Cited Standards FY2024, OSHA-Regulated Hazardous Chemicals PEL Reference 2026, Named Process Safety + Industrial Disasters Extended Reference 2026, and the HSE Acronym Dictionary 2026. Coverage: 15 countries × 20+ industries (performance metrics); US, UK, GCC (UAE, Saudi Arabia, Qatar, Oman, Bahrain, Kuwait), EU, Australia, Canada (regulations); 43 named process-safety and industrial disasters (1911–2024); 150+ HSE acronyms; 130+ glossary terms; 30 OSHA-regulated chemicals with PELs; top-30 most-cited OSHA standards FY2024. Sources: US Bureau of Labor Statistics (SOII 2024, CFOI 2024), US Occupational Safety and Health Administration enforcement data, US Chemical Safety Board investigation reports, UK Health and Safety Executive RIDDOR statistics, International Association of Oil and Gas Producers (IOGP 2023), International Labour Organization, Eurostat, NIOSH, ACGIH, Safe Work Australia, and labour ministries of the UAE (MOHRE), Saudi Arabia (MHRSD), Qatar, Oman, Bahrain (MLSD), and Kuwait (MSAL). Distribution: Each dataset is mirrored to (i) Zenodo with a permanent DOI, (ii) HuggingFace Datasets, and (iii) Wikidata as a structured-data entity.
